A note on weight loss. Taking meat out of your diet will often times make you lose weight, especially if you are an overeater. The same can be said for taking milk and egg products from your diet.

When I first switched to a vegetarian lifestyle I lost 85 pounds in about 8 months. I let my diet get away from me with greasy cheesy foods and gained back 15 of that, but still after 13 months I had equalized at 215 down from 285 and from 38% to 24% body fat.

This last week I've started losing again, down to 23% body fat. Just a week I know, but it is easy to understand that taking out those calorie dense foods makes it harder to overindulge.

I've been eating more than I have in a long time, feeling full, but I'm not getting bogged down with all the bad stuff.
